Flood damage restoration services involve the assessment, cleanup, and repair of properties affected by flooding events. These services typically include water extraction, removal of saturated materials, drying and dehumidification, mold prevention, and structural repairs. The goal is to restore the property to a safe and habitable condition by addressing both visible damage and hidden issues caused by excess moisture. Professional restoration providers utilize specialized equipment and techniques to efficiently mitigate the impact of flooding and prevent further deterioration.
Flooding can lead to a range of problems for property owners, including structural damage, mold growth, and compromised indoor air quality. Water intrusion can weaken foundations, warp flooring, and damage walls and ceilings. If not promptly addressed, lingering moisture can promote mold and bacteria development, which pose health risks and can be costly to remediate. Restoration services help resolve these issues by thoroughly removing water and contaminated materials, drying affected areas, and implementing measures to prevent mold growth, thereby reducing long-term damage and health hazards.

The overview below groups typical Flood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chester Springs, PA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Assessment and Inspection Costs - Initial flood damage assessments typically range from $200 to $600, depending on the property size and extent of damage. Inspections help determine the necessary restoration steps and costs involved.
Water Extraction Expenses - Removing standing water after flooding usually costs between $1,000 and $3,500. Factors influencing the price include water volume and equipment used by local service providers.
Structural Drying and Dehumidification - Drying out affected areas can cost approximately $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the size of the space and severity of moisture intrusion. Proper drying is essential to prevent mold growth.
Cleanup and Restoration Costs - Complete cleanup and restoration services generally range from $3,000 to $15,000. The final cost varies based on the extent of damage, materials affected, and necessary repairs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the common signs of flood damage? Signs include water stains on walls or ceilings, a musty odor, warped flooring, and visible water or mud deposits.
How long does flood damage restoration typically take? Restoration duration varies based on the extent of damage, but local service providers can assess the specific needs of a property in Chester Springs, PA.
Is it necessary to replace drywall and flooring after a flood? Not always; some materials can be cleaned and dried, but severely damaged drywall and flooring often require replacement to prevent mold growth.
What steps do restoration professionals take to prevent mold? They remove excess moisture, thoroughly dry affected areas, and treat surfaces to inhibit mold growth.
